College Glen is a residential street with 58 addresses.
It ranks as the 878th largest and 332nd most expensive of the 1,061 streets in the SL6 area. The dominant property type is a period house built between 1800 and 1911.
The street contains a total of 58 properties: 58 houses.
Sale prices range from £428,983 for 2 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(678 ft2) to £668,211 for 4 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(1,431 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£1,740 pcm for 2 bed houses to £2,497 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 4.5% and 4.9%.
The average value per square foot is £595.
The last sale on College Glen sold for £480,000 on 20th February 2026. Since then prices are up an average of 1.0%.
The current average value in the street is £506,771.
The College Glen Sales Market has increased by 16.8% over the last 10 years.

The last sale was on 20th February 2026 for £480,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 1.0%. The street has had a total of 156 sales since 1995.
College Glen, Maidenhead, SL6 has seen 12 sales in the last three years and 3 sales in the last twelve months.
College Glen, Maidenhead, SL6 is the 878th largest and the 332nd most expensive street in the SL6 area.
There is 1 postcode on College Glen, Maidenhead, SL6.
The closest station to College Glen, Maidenhead, SL6 is Furze Platt station which is 1.0 kilometres away.
